Navigating Plant-Based Dining in Woodstock, NY

The following provides guidance for those seeking entirely plant-based dining options in Woodstock, New York, aimed at optimizing the dining experience.

Tip 1: Research Menus in Advance: Prior to visiting, examine online menus. Many establishments post their menus online, allowing prospective diners to assess available options and identify dishes aligned with their preferences or dietary needs.

Tip 2: Inquire About Ingredients and Preparation: Do not hesitate to ask staff about the specific ingredients used in dishes and their preparation methods. This is especially important for individuals with allergies or specific dietary requirements to ensure compliance.

Tip 3: Consider Peak Hours: Popular establishments may experience increased wait times during peak dining hours. Plan accordingly or inquire about reservation options to minimize potential delays.

Tip 4: Explore Seasonal Offerings: Many restaurants emphasize the use of locally sourced, seasonal produce. Inquiring about seasonal specials can lead to unique and fresh culinary experiences.

Tip 5: Evaluate Accessibility and Ambiance: Consider factors such as parking availability, accessibility for individuals with disabilities, and the overall ambiance of the establishment to ensure a comfortable and enjoyable dining experience.

Tip 6: Read Online Reviews: Consult online review platforms to gain insights into the experiences of previous diners. This can provide valuable information regarding food quality, service, and overall customer satisfaction.

Tip 7: Support Local and Sustainable Practices: Prioritize establishments that emphasize sustainable sourcing and local ingredients, thereby contributing to the local economy and environmental responsibility.

6. Nutritional Value

6. Nutritional Value, Restaurant

The nutritional value of meals offered by vegan restaurants in Woodstock, NY, is a primary concern for both patrons and restaurant operators. This concern arises from the inherent complexities of plant-based diets, which, while offering potential health benefits, necessitate careful planning to ensure adequate intake of essential nutrients. The impact of these eating habits has become obvious. Iron, vitamin B12, and omega-3 fatty acids are crucial nutrients. Plant-based dining is popular because these diets are typically higher in fiber, vitamins, and minerals while also being low in saturated fat and cholesterol. This makes plant-based diets potentially effective for reducing the risk of heart disease, type 2 diabetes, and certain cancers. However, proper planning is essential. Restaurants emphasizing dishes composed of whole, unprocessed plant foods such as whole grains, legumes, vegetables, fruits, nuts, and seeds can maximize the nutritional benefits. Supplementation of vitamin B12, which is not naturally found in plant-based foods, is often recommended, especially for those following a strict vegan diet.
